Performance Analysis of Cognitive Radio Networks With Location Privacy Preservation Ryutaro Kobuchi (Osaka Univ.), Tatsuaki Kimura (Doshisha Univ.), Tetsuya Takine (Osaka Univ.) |

With the rapid increase in demand for wireless communication services, dynamic spectrum sharing in cognitive radio networks has received growing attention for efficiently utilizing limited radio resources.
In cognitive radio networks, users are classified into primary and cognitive users, and cognitive users are authorized to transmit data when they do not affect the
communication quality of primary users. To achieve this, a primary user pre-sends his/her location information to a spectrum ad-
ministrator. Therefore, protecting the location privacy of primary users is a critical issue in cognitive radio networks. In this study,
we consider a cognitive radio network in which a primary user preserves his/her location privacy based on geo-indistinguishability
and theoretically analyze the communication performance via a stochastic geometry approach. We assume a transmitter-receiver
pair for primary users and model the locations of transmitters and receives of cognitive users by 2D Poisson point processes.
We also assume that the primary receiver sends a randomized location to a spectrum administrator by adding noise based on
geo-indistinguishability. We analyze the outage probability of each user in this model and theoretically evaluate the impact of
location privacy protection on communication quality. |
